Hidden House Pests
Are you familiar with the surprise family pests that may be prowling in your home? While you may be vigilant about typical parasites like ants or crawlers, there are various other stealthy intruders that could be triggering harm behind the scenes.
One such bug is the silverfish, a little pest that flourishes in wet and dark atmospheres like cellars and washrooms. These bugs can harm publications, garments, and also wallpaper, making them a problem to deal with.
One more covert bug to look out for is the rug beetle. These tiny pests prey on a selection of products discovered in homes, such as carpetings, apparel, and upholstery. Their larvae can create significant damages if left untreated, making it important to deal with any kind of indicators of infestation without delay.
Additionally, mold and mildew termites are usually forgotten however can indicate a moisture concern in your house. These small animals feed upon mold and can get worse allergic reactions for sensitive individuals. Keeping your home dry and well-ventilated can assist prevent these pests from settling in your home.

Sneaky Home Invaders
While you may be diligent in keeping your home tidy and organized, sly home intruders can still find their way in undetected. These bugs are masters of concealing in ordinary sight, making it crucial to remain alert in spotting their visibility.
Here are a couple of sly home invaders you should keep an eye out for:
1. ** Silverfish **: These little, silvery bugs like moist, dark areas like cellars and washrooms. They feed on starchy materials and can create damages to publications, wallpaper, and apparel.
2. ** Carpeting Beetles **: Usually incorrect for safe ladybugs, carpet beetles can damage your home. Their larvae feed on natural fibers like woollen and silk, triggering irreversible damage to carpets, garments, and upholstery.
3. ** Earwigs **: Despite their ominous-looking pincers, earwigs are even more of a nuisance than a risk. They're brought in to moisture and can discover their means into your home through cracks and crevices. Watch out for them in damp locations like bathroom and kitchens.
